The video reviews universal gravitation topics for the AP Physics 1 exam, focusing on Newton's universal law of gravitation, the differences between planet-specific and universal gravity equations, and the concept of gravitational fields. It explains how to calculate satellite velocity and discusses gravitational potential energy in both constant and non-constant fields. The lesson concludes with a preview of the next topic, simple harmonic motion.
